This is shopkeeper in German, this was in the middle of the town right across from the hospital. The cool thing about this place was that it was also right next to the previous buildings I posted about and in front of the shop was the train station.

As you can see the shopkeeper stayed here and was one of the richest people in the town. Definitely had some of the fanciest furniture of everyone in the town.

Not sure what all the broken things are in the bottom of the cupboard, but this is the only house in the whole ghost town which has furniture in it. Only the hall has some things in. Most of the items in the house were donated by the families of the people who stayed there, not all of the furniture is actually from that time or that actual house, but it gives it a really nice look.IMG_20180701_102909.jpg
